    Amigos, I may have an explanation for the delay in FBM's drilling. I have shares in both FBM and CZN (Corazon) and both have lithium prospects near to each other - south of Coolgardie - FBM is more advanced in its exploration. I'm not tryng to cross-promote and don't recommend that you get into CZN if you have a faint heart. The point is, both companies have been delayed with their drilling programs for lithium. A recent presentation by the manager of CZN, Brett Smith, said that the Environment Dept in WA is the fly in the ointment. It sounds like it is a new department and it is finding its way. Several other explorers appear to be in the same boat. So pressure could be building on the Dept. Perhaps there will be an improved approach sooner or later, but we wait and see. (CZN's hold up was an historical gold mine on its ground plus the possibility of rare native species, but it seems to have gotten approval now from the dept and has recently submitted its drilling to the Mines dept. It has taken more than 5 months by my caclulation.)
